The Benefits of UPVC Door and Windows

Upvc doors and windows provide many advantages to their owners. The advantages include energy efficiency and durability as well as ease of maintenance. Additionally windows and doors made of upvc are also green.

Durability

Durability is an important aspect to take into consideration when selecting doors and windows. The material you use will last for an extended period of time and provide you with high security.

There are several materials that can be used for windows and doors. You can pick from aluminum, wood, or uPVC. These materials are renowned for their durability.

Unlike wooden doors, uPVC doors don't rot, fade, or break. They are also immune to rust, mold and water. UPVC's strength is a result of the manufacturing process.

When compared to traditional windows made of wood, uPVC's insulation capabilities ensure that your home stays warm in winter and cool in summer. This can enable you to save money on your energy bills.

The durability and eco-efficiency of UPVC makes it a perfect choice for homes in areas in which rain is a problem. uPVC windows and doors are a good option for homes where water and humidity can cause damage as like ultraviolet radiation.

Windows and doors made of uPVC are durable since they don't need any chemicals to soften. They are also cost-effective and easy-to-maintenance. Moreover, uPVC can be recycled.

It is also possible to mix laminated glass with a uPVC frame for increased security. To strengthen the frame, you can include steel reinforcements.

Lastly, uPVC is very noise-reducing. It is extremely durable and does not need to be refinished often. If you are looking to replace your doors and windows, uPVC will be your best choice.

Low maintenance

UPVC is a flexible and sturdy material for windows and doors. It is extremely resistant to heat, cold and sun. It is also low-maintenance and chemical-resistant.

It's different from wood in that it isn't affected by warp, rot, or corrode. This means you can put up uPVC doors without worrying about the environmental impact. These products also offer a variety of designs and colors. You can easily customize them to suit your needs.

Another advantage of UPVC is its excellent insulation properties. This makes it an excellent option for window frames of any kind of building. They are resistant to cold and damp and keep warm air from venting out.

UPVC can also be used in conjunction with double glazed panes made of glass. This can help reduce the temperature of the room and also reduce noise levels. Additionally, UPVC is resistant to moisture. Internal glazing can also be used to keep burglars from gaining entry into your home.

Environment-friendly

uPVC windows are a green option if you're searching for windows that are robust and energy efficient. They are recyclable and an excellent option for your home. uPVC windows are not only eco-friendly but also energy efficient. They cut down on the use of electricity and gas to heat your home.

uPVC is also energy efficient, and has additional advantages. It is an excellent insulation material that can keep your space warmer and dryer for a longer period of time.

UPVC is also a highly durable material. You won't have to replace your windows and doors as often. The frames are reusable more than 10 times.

Another benefit of uPVC is its ability to stand up to extreme temperatures. This makes it ideal for use as shower curtains or fencing. Likewise, uPVC's dustproof quality allows it to be used for many different uses.

It is also easy to recycle. Numerous manufacturers utilize uPVC waste to make PVC pipes. There is also a plant in Germany which is able to recycle around 50,000 tonnes of uPVC every year.

Another factor to be considered is the carbon footprint. It is calculated by estimation of the amount of carbon dioxide emitted per household. You can reduce your carbon footprint by installing uPVC.
